Planning, launching, and growing a podcast can seem daunting, but with the right guidance and advice from experienced podcasters, it is possible. Veteran podcasters like Joe Saul-Sehy from Stacking Benjamins, Kristen Meinser, and Jordan Harbinger have all successfully launched and grown their podcasts and have valuable insights to share. 
We hear about the planning, shaping, and bumps and bruises of launching from the new host Allen Corey and Crystal Hammond of their spin-off show Stacking Deeds.
Take Aways
Sometimes a "No" is a Not Now.
Your podcast can bring you opportunities.
Diverse attitudes, experiences, and insights lead to a diverse audience.
Ensure that your show's first five minutes inspire people to want to hear more.
Joe truly appreciated the feedback that provided ways to improve his show.
Listen back to your show to catch mistakes you may have missed.
Learning to edit your show improves your relationship with a future editor.
They didn't release the first thing they recorded.
How they improved after a "brutal conversation."
The Importance of incorporating listener feedback into the show. 
Advertisers are Partners that You've already worked with.
Start building relationships before you launch your show and build your network.
Know a person who knows the "WHO" in the industry and reach out.
